Biogas, a methane (CH4)-containing gas resulting from the decomposition of organic matter under anaerobic conditions, can be produced from a wide variety of organic feedstocks, including food waste, agricultural residues, and manure. MCS certifies low-carbon products and installations used to produce electricity and heat from renewable sources. Membership of MCS demonstrates adherence to these recognised industry standards; highlighting quality, competency and compliance.
